How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ration Works
The process of restoring your home’s wood trim after water damage involves several key steps. It starts with a thorough inspection to assess the extent of the damage. Our technicians use specialized equipment to find out the best course of action and create a customized plan. From there, we’ll extract the water, dry the affected area, and repair or replace any damaged wood trim. We’ll also work with your insurance company to ensure a smooth claims process.
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our technicians will carefully inspect the damaged area to find out the extent of the dam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ect any hidden moisture and create a customized plan to restore your home’s wood trim.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using powerful pumps and vacuums, our technicians will extract the water from the affected area. This is a critical step in preventing further damage and ensuring the integrity of your home’s structure.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our technicians will use specialized equipment to dry the affected area and remove any excess moisture. This helps prevent mold and mildew growth and ensures the wood trim can be restored to its original condition.
Step 4: Repair and Replacement
Once the area is dry, our technicians will repair or replace any damaged wood trim. We’ll use high-quality materials and techniques to ensure the restored area is strong and durable.

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ration Cost in Wake Forest, NC
The cost of wood trim water damage restoration can v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Wake Forest, NC. These estimates are based on real-world costs and may vary depending on your specific situation. Here’s a breakdown of the typical price range for each aspect of the job: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Inspection and Assessment | $200 – $500 | The sever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. |
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,000 | The amount of water extracted and the equipment used.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the equipment used. |
| Repair and Replacement |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ials used. |
| Insurance and Claims | $0 – $500 | The complexity of the claims process and the documentation required. |
